On May 22 local time, the Ukrainian ambassador to the UK and former Commander-in-Chief of the Ukrainian Armed Forces, Zaluzhny, stated at a forum held in Kiev that Ukraine should give up restoring the borders defined when the Soviet Union collapsed in 1991, or even abandon restoring the borders defined when the special military operation began in 2022. He said, "Personally, I believe that the enemy (Russia) still has sufficient resources, military strength, and methods to strike Ukraine."
Zaluzhny said, "Dear attendees, do not still hope for some kind of miracle or lucky symbol that will bring peace to Ukraine - that is, restoring the borders of 1991 or 2022, followed by immense happiness."
Zaluzhny was relieved of his post as commander-in-chief of the armed forces in February 2024, reportedly due to months of disagreement with President Zelenskyy, whose term was expiring.
